MATURE SKIN

Aging is a natural and aesthetically pleasing stage of life that brings with it valuable life experiences, cherished memories, and the joy of watching one’s family grow and evolve over time. However, as the years go by, the skin undergoes changes as well. The skin loses collagen and elasticity, resulting in increased fragility. Furthermore, a decrease in the production of hyaluronic acid, a substance that absorbs water in the skin, can cause a thinning and dull appearance. As a result, wrinkles, fine lines, age spots, and growths such as skin tags and warts, and even skin cancers can develop. In women, menopause can directly impact hormone levels, further altering the quality, texture, and elasticity of the skin.

Although these changes are a natural part of aging, it is possible to stimulate collagen production and increase hyaluronic acid to maintain a youthful, healthy, and radiant appearance.
